Thousands of students gathered at the Raju Sculpture in Dhaka’s TSC area to observe the "Shahidi March" - marking the one-month anniversary of the fall of Sheikh Hasina’s government and honouring those martyred during the recent protests.

People had already begun assembling at the site since afternoon on Thursday (5 September).

The gathering grew as they chanted various slogans in remembrance of the martyrs, such as: “In memory of the martyrs, we fear no death,” “Our martyrs, our strength,” “Abu Sayed-Mugdha, the fight isn't over,” “In the flag of red and green, the martyrs are seen,” “The students have awakened,” “The blood boils with fire,” and “Where has Chhatra League gone?”

The march began at 3pm and will move through Nilkhet, New Market, Kalabagan, Mirpur Road, and Manik Mia Avenue, passing by the Parliament Building, Farmgate, Karwan Bazar, Shahbagh, and the Raju Sculpture, before concluding at the Central Shaheed Minar.
